Washington, DC, June 22, 2023 — Yesterday, as part of his official state visit to the U.S., Prime Minister Modi was welcomed to the White House this morning by President Biden, First Lady Dr. Jill Biden, and thousands of Indian-Americans. The two leaders engaged in productive conversations in restricted and delegation-level formats, discussing important issues such as trade, investment, defense, security, energy, climate change, and people-to-people ties.

Indian Prime Minister Narendra Modi attended a private event hosted by U.S. President Joe Biden and First Lady Dr. Jill Biden at the White House. During the event, he had the opportunity to meet the Bidens’ immediate family members and reaffirm the strong friendship between the two countries.

Today, Prime Minister Modi addressed a Joint Sitting of the U.S. Congress at the invitation of several Congressional leaders, including Speaker Kevin McCarthy and Vice President Kamala Harris. He expressed his appreciation for the bipartisan support for India-US relations in the U.S. Congress and shared his vision for elevating bilateral ties. The Prime Minister also highlighted the significant progress made by India and the opportunities it presents for the world. Speaker McCarthy hosted a reception in honor of the Prime Minister, who marked his second address to the Joint Sitting of the U.S. Congress.
